Scope
This standard specifies electrochemical sensor methods for the determination of nine harmful gases in ambient air, including chlorine, hydrogen sulfide, hydrogen chloride, carbon monoxide, hydrogen cyanide, phosgene, hydrogen fluoride, ammonia and sulfur dioxide. This standard is a qualitative and semi-quantitative method, suitable for on-site emergency monitoring of harmful gases such as chlorine, hydrogen sulfide, hydrogen chloride, carbon monoxide, hydrogen cyanide, phosgene, hydrogen fluoride, ammonia and sulfur dioxide in ambient air, as well as for preliminary screening, census, etc. Investigative work. See Appendix A for common measurement ranges of target objects.
